Answer:

The current density of the solution in m^2 is 11100A/m^2

Step-by-step explanation:

<em>One square decimeter is equal to 0.01 square meter,</em> Thus the current density in square meters is

\frac{111A}{dm^2} =\frac{111A}{0.01m^2} =\frac{111}{0.01}*\frac{A}{m^2}=\boxed{11100A/m^2}

11100 Amperes per square meter.
